Mornings are hard, especially for teenagers who often struggle more than most to get at school on time.

Students at Troup High School are receiving a little extra motivation this yeah however, thanks to the donation of a new car from Kia of LaGrange.

Students who maintain good grades, have good behavior and good attendance will be entered to win a 2017 Kia Rio.

There’s a stricter policy on school attendance this year, so Troup High is doing its best to get students excited about attending class. The car giveaway from Kia gives a great incentive for students to attend all of their classes at Troup County High School.

Those who meet standards of good behavior, good grades and attendance will have their names put in for the drawing every nine weeks.

At the end of the year, the school will draw one name for the car. Along the way, the school will draw names from the students entered for smaller giveaways, like gift cards and t-shirts, every nine weeks.

The car is a good incentive to get students to attend class because it gives them something to care for every day of the school year. Students cannot miss the same class four times without facing penalties, such as weekend classes or summer school.

Studies show that regular attendance results in improved grades. That only makes sense. The more students are in class, the more they should learn.
